Basketball Recap: STX Saints vs. Science and Tech Stingrays
STX hasn't had much luck on the road recently (they'd lost three straight) but thanks in part to Caedmon Williams that streak is no more. The STX Saints breezed by the Science and Tech Stingrays to the tune of 69-35 on Saturday thanks in part to Williams, who went 6 of 9 from beyond the arc on his way to 24 points and three steals. That makes it three consecutive games in which he has scored at least a third of STX's points.

The team also got some help courtesy of Lucian Lopez, who went 5 for 12 en route to 11 points in addition to six boards and three steals. Those three steals gave him a new career-high.
STX's win bumped their record up to 14-12. As for Science and Tech, their defeat dropped their record down to 2-8.
The future could be bright for both STX and Science and Tech: their next opponents haven't had the best luck recently. STX will try to hand San Isidro their fourth-straight loss when the two meet at 7:00 p.m. on February 4th. Similarly, Science and Tech will look to extend Corpus Christi United's four-game losing streak when the meet at 6:00 p.m. on Thursday.
